Ingredients
1Tbsp(15 mL) canola oil
1/2cup(125 mL) finely chopped red bell pepper
1/2cup(125 mL) finely chopped green bell pepper
1/2cup(125 mL) finely chopped white onion
1/4cup(60 mL) grated carrot
1smalljalapeno pepper, finely chopped, optional
1cup(250 mL) cooked or canned black beans, drained & rinsed
5largeeggs
2Tbsp(30 mL) milk
1/2tsp(2 mL) salt
1/4tsp(1 mL) black pepper
3/4cup(175 mL) shredded cheddar cheese
Instructions
Preheat oven to 350°F (180°C).
Lightly grease mini muffin pan(s) with cooking spray.
In a large skillet, heat oil over medium temperature. Add red and green peppers, onion, carrots and jalapeno pepper (if using) and sauté until slightly tender, about 5 minutes.
Remove from heat and stir in black beans.
In large bowl, use a fork to whisk together eggs, milk, salt and pepper. Stir in the bean and vegetable mixture.
Scoop 3-4 Tbsp (45-60 mL) of the mixture into the prepared mini muffin pan(s). You should get about 24 egg bites.
Top with shredded cheddar cheese.
Bake in pre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, until egg is set and cooked through. Remove from oven, place on wire cooling rack and let stand for 5 minutes before removing the egg bites from the pan.
Serve warm or cool and refrigerate for meals or snacks-on-the go!
Notes
Want more heat? Use a larger jalapeno pepper and/or add a few drops of hot sauce when whisking the eggs, milk and seasonings together!
Switch up the veggies with whatever you have in the fridge to make this recipe your own.
Feel free to add a bit of bacon or ham or any leftover meat you have on hand!
